The 9th World Bamboo Congress invites Papers
The 9th World Bamboo Congress will be organized from April 10-13, 2012 at Antwerp, Belgium. The theme for this congress is “Bamboo Biosciences, Bioengineering and Agroforestry Potentials”. Institute of World Policy announces internships for European and American young people in Ukraine
The Institute of World Policy (IWP) has announced an internship program for young people from Europe and the US. The minimum duration of the internship period is 2 weeks.
